Position : Data Platform Engineer
Salary : RM 5000 - RM 7000 (Depends on experience)
Location : Asia Jaya, Petaling Jaya
Working day : Mon - Fri (9 am - 6 pm)
:
To act as a member of the Delivery team responsible for our backend systems, databases, internal APIs, Elastic search implementation, and other systems. To deliver software and systems improvements, new features, and new products on time and match our coding standards.
Key Accountability : Software Development and Maintenance
Development of high-quality backend systems using Python
Expand and improve the functionality of existing components and libraries
Maintenance of our systems, including minor enhancements and bug fixes
Provide estimates of work to be completed
Advise on technical solutions already available in the market or available through open-source projects
Key Accountability : Application Support
Communication about application logic to other teams
Presentation of key learnings and expertise to others in the company
Key Accountability : Code Quality
Uphold, and add to, the standards set for code quality
Write automated tests for our new applications and systems
Job Requirements :
At least 3 years working with Python in a professional environment
Experience with Python frameworks such as Django and Flask
Experience with a Python ORM (e.g. SQLAlchemy)
Experience with a Gevent or another asynchronous library
Ability to model data and optimize performance in MySQL
Understand the difference between multiprocessing, multithreading, and event-based servers
Have used automation technologies such as Ansible, Docker, Vagrant, Travis CI, etc.
Be able to use Linux/macOS on a daily basis; comfortable on the command line
C
M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.